Group 1: Global Governance Initiatives - The core viewpoint emphasizes the need for a more just and reasonable global governance system, as proposed by President Xi Jinping during the Shanghai Cooperation Organization summit [1] - The global governance initiative is presented as a significant public product from China, following previous initiatives focused on development, security, and civilization [1][4] - The initiative aims to address the increasing deficits in peace, development, security, and governance globally [1] Group 2: Economic Cooperation and Development - Cooperation and win-win outcomes are highlighted as essential for promoting sustainable global development, especially in the face of rising unilateralism and protectionism [2] - The World Bank has revised its global economic growth forecast for 2025 down to 2.3%, indicating challenges in the global development process [2] - China's initiatives, such as the Belt and Road Initiative, have reportedly lifted over 40 million people out of poverty and facilitated significant trade with partner countries [3] Group 3: Global Security Initiatives - The global security initiative advocates for a comprehensive, cooperative, and sustainable security approach, gaining support from over 130 countries and international organizations [7] - The initiative emphasizes the importance of dialogue over confrontation and partnership over alliances, aiming to create a new security paradigm [7] - China's role as a peace builder is reinforced through various international forums and initiatives aimed at conflict resolution and security cooperation [6] Group 4: Cultural Exchange and Civilizational Dialogue - The global civilization initiative promotes mutual understanding and respect among different cultures, aiming to build a harmonious world [12] - The establishment of an International Day for Civilizational Dialogue reflects the core principles of the global civilization initiative [12] - China's commitment to cultural exchange is demonstrated through various platforms that facilitate dialogue and cooperation among diverse civilizations [10][11] Group 5: Fairness and Justice in Global Governance - The pursuit of fairness and justice is identified as a fundamental goal for achieving a just international order, especially in the context of current global challenges [13] - China's advocacy for multilateralism and equitable international relations is positioned as a response to the need for a more effective global governance framework [16] - The establishment of international mediation institutions aims to provide new avenues for peacefully resolving international disputes [15]
